### What are Word Clouds?

Word clouds, generically known as tag clouds, are a type of data visualization where the frequency of words or themes mentioned in a text body is represented visually. The size of each word in the cloud corresponds to its frequency – the more frequently a word appears in the text, the larger it becomes in the illustration. This visual representation makes it easy to identify the most prominent themes, emotions, or concepts in vast sets of data.

### Key Features of Word Cloud Generators

Word clouds are versatile because they can be generated from any text data set, whether it’s a collection of articles, social media feeds, customer feedback, scientific papers, or personal diaries. Here are some key features you should look for in a word cloud generator:

1. **Text Input**: The ability to directly input text content or upload files containing the text data.
2. **Customizability**: Options to choose font styles, color schemes, and layout options to match your specific needs or add aesthetic appeal.
3. **Word Count Settings**: Adjustment abilities to include or exclude words based on their length or frequency, helping in filtering out less significant words or over-cluttering the cloud.
4. **Layout Options**: Selection from various layout options to arrange words in a visually pleasing manner.
5. **Exporting Options**: The ability to export the generated word cloud in different formats (JPEG, PNG, SVG, etc.) for sharing or integrating into reports or presentations.

### How to Create and Use Word Clouds to Unlock Insights

1. **Data Selection**: First, you need to select the text data you want to analyze. This could be a single document, a set of documents, or a dataset containing multiple documents.
2. **Data Preparation**: If data needs to be processed (e.g., text cleaning, sentiment analysis, categorization), ensure it’s done before you input the data into the word cloud generator.
3. **Generating the Word Cloud**: Use your chosen word cloud generator to input the text data. Follow the steps provided by the generator to customize the look and feel of your word cloud.
4. **Interpreting the Visuals**: Examine the word cloud for the largest and most frequent words. These are often the key themes or topics surrounding the data. Look for patterns or clusters of words as they can reveal deeper insights.
5. **Analyzing Trends and Comparisons**: If possible, generate word clouds from similar data sets at different times to identify trends or changes in the data. This can be particularly useful in market analysis, content analysis, or any scenario where you need to understand changes over time.

### Applying Word Clouds Beyond Entertainment

While word clouds can add a touch of visual interest to your work, they are incredibly useful for data interpretation. They can help answer several key questions in various fields:

– **Market Research**: By visualizing customer feedback, companies can quickly identify common issues, praises, or product trends.
– **Academic Research**: In fields like linguistics or literary analysis, word clouds can highlight recurring terms or patterns in texts, aiding in the understanding and interpretation of data.
– **Content Creation**: Bloggers and content creators use word clouds to understand their audience’s interests and improve their content’s relevance.
– **Sentiment Analysis**: By quantifying the sentiment of a text corpus, word clouds can indicate the overall tone or mood of online conversations, social media trends, or customer reviews.
